Sofas Contain POPs
Makers in the past added fire retardants containing harmful organic pollutants to the majority of fabric couches.
SEPA regulations dictate that you must incinerate any sofa categorised as waste upholstered domestic seating containing persistent organic pollutants at a licensed facility. Putting it in landfill is strictly prohibited.
It is a frequently overlooked fact that waste disposal firms prohibit the inclusion of POP materials within their conventional, general-purpose skip services.

What are WUDS and POPs?
The term WUDS relates to Waste Upholstered Domestic Seating, including an unwanted sofa bed in your spare room. Manufacturers frequently treated these items with flame retardants including Persistent Organic Pollutants, commonly known as POPs. It is the presence of these chemicals that poses significant challenges when you need to safely discard your old household furniture.
How does SEPA’s WUDS guidance affect Sofa Disposal?
Latest SEPA guidance on SUDs and WUDS unavoidably raises disposal costs for upholstered furniture. Charity outlets must now tighten their acceptance criteria to avoid these significant waste charges on unsold stock. Consequently, illegal dumping will grow. We observed this exact pattern when fridge and mattress disposal fees spiked, leaving our roadsides and fields strewn with abandoned items.
